How they compare
Timor-Leste currently reports 34,011 number against 31,098 number in Latvia, a difference of 2,913 number.
That makes Timor-Leste's figure about 1.1 times Latvia's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 2008 it was Latvia ahead.
Latvia ranks 133rd and Timor-Leste ranks 130th of 187 countries.
Latvia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Total number of male students enrolled in public and private upper secondary education institutions regardless of age. For more information, consult the UIS website: http://www.uis.unesco.org/Education/
